Product Description:  
 
This outstanding resource is focused specifically on law and ethics on dental hygiene market. It thoroughly addresses topics taught in the required ethics and law course for dental hygienists, written by a well-known, respected author and expert contributors. Separate, balanced discussions of ethics and law introduce readers to each subject and then demonstrate how they interact in situations in the dental office.The ethics section explains high standards of self-regulated behavior that cannot be expressed exclusively by laws. The section on law delineates the rules and regulations that apply to dental hygienists. Case studies draw these two topics together, illustrating specific legal and ethical dilemmas to help readers understand how to make well-informed, ethical decisions.
